Welcome to the forum Vincent. Succulents grow best outdoors in full sun, when indoors it's difficult to provide the necessary light for a happy plant. You could supplement the needed light with a T5 HO 65K fixture/bulb, these start about $20 at Amazon. In the mean time place these guys in a west or south window, direct light is key.
